?? poweru.lst.1
字號:
文件:PowerU.c 盛群編譯器版本 3.00 頁次1
1 0000 #pragma debug scope 1 1
70 0000 #line 70 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
70 0000 __acsr EQU [023H]
70 0000 __adcr EQU [022H]
70 0000 __adrh EQU [021H]
70 0000 __adrl EQU [020H]
70 0000 __pwm0 EQU [01fH]
70 0000 __intc1 EQU [01eH]
70 0000 __ctrl1 EQU [01bH]
70 0000 __ctrl0 EQU [01aH]
70 0000 __pcpu EQU [019H]
70 0000 __pcc EQU [018H]
70 0000 __pc EQU [017H]
70 0000 __pbpu EQU [016H]
70 0000 __pbc EQU [015H]
70 0000 __pb EQU [014H]
70 0000 __pawk EQU [013H]
70 0000 __papu EQU [012H]
70 0000 __pac EQU [011H]
70 0000 __pa EQU [010H]
70 0000 __tmr0c EQU [0dH]
70 0000 __tmr0 EQU [0cH]
70 0000 __intc0 EQU [0bH]
70 0000 __status EQU [0aH]
70 0000 __wdts EQU [09H]
70 0000 __tblh EQU [08H]
70 0000 __tblp EQU [07H]
70 0000 __pcl EQU [06H]
70 0000 __acc EQU [05H]
70 0000 __mp1 EQU [03H]
70 0000 __mp0 EQU [01H]
70 0000 __iar1 EQU [02H]
70 0000 __iar0 EQU [00H]
70 0000 @All_LED_Off .SECTION 'CODE'
70 0000 PUBLIC _All_LED_Off
70 0000 _All_LED_Off PROC
70 0000 #pragma debug scope 2 1 ; 71 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
71 0000 #line 71 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
71 0000 3414 CLR [014H].0
72 0001 #line 72 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
72 0001 3494 CLR [014H].1
73 0002 #line 73 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
73 0002 3514 CLR [014H].2
74 0003 #line 74 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
74 0003 3594 CLR [014H].3
75 0004 #line 75 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
75 0004 3614 CLR [014H].4
75 0005 L1:
75 0005 0003 RET
75 0006 _All_LED_Off ENDP
79 0006 #line 79 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
79 0000 @All_LED_ON .SECTION 'CODE'
79 0000 PUBLIC _All_LED_ON
79 0000 _All_LED_ON PROC
79 0000 #pragma debug scope 3 1 ; 80 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
80 0000 #line 80 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
80 0000 3014 SET [014H].0
81 0001 #line 81 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
文件:PowerU.c 盛群編譯器版本 3.00 頁次2
81 0001 3094 SET [014H].1
82 0002 #line 82 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
82 0002 3114 SET [014H].2
83 0003 #line 83 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
83 0003 3194 SET [014H].3
84 0004 #line 84 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
84 0004 3214 SET [014H].4
84 0005 L2:
84 0005 0003 RET
84 0006 _All_LED_ON ENDP
88 0006 #line 88 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
88 0000 @ADC_GetBatteryData .SECTION 'CODE'
88 0000 PUBLIC _ADC_GetBatteryData
88 0000 _ADC_GetBatteryData PROC
88 0000 #pragma debug scope 4 1 ; 89 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
89 0000 #line 89 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
89 0000 37A2 CLR [022H].7
90 0001 #line 90 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
90 0001 33A2 SET [022H].7
91 0002 #line 91 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
91 0002 37A2 CLR [022H].7
91 0003 #line 91 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
91 0003 2800 R JMP L5
91 0004 L4:
95 0004 #line 95 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
95 0004 0001 clr wdt
95 0005 L5:
95 0005 #pragma debug scope 5 4 ; 92 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
92 0005 #line 92 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
92 0005 #pragma debug scope 4 1 ; 92 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
92 0005 3F22 SZ [022H].6
92 0006 2800 R JMP L4
98 0007 #line 98 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
98 0007 37A2 CLR [022H].7
99 0008 #line 99 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
99 0008 33A2 SET [022H].7
100 0009 #line 100 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
100 0009 37A2 CLR [022H].7
100 000A #line 100 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
100 000A 2800 R JMP L8
100 000B L7:
104 000B #line 104 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
104 000B 0001 clr wdt
104 000C L8:
104 000C #pragma debug scope 6 4 ; 101 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
101 000C #line 101 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
101 000C #pragma debug scope 4 1 ; 101 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
101 000C 3F22 SZ [022H].6
101 000D 2800 R JMP L7
107 000E #line 107 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
107 000E 0721 MOV A,__adrh
107 000F 0080 R MOV _tempinta,A
107 0010 1F00 R CLR _tempinta[1]
108 0011 #line 108 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
108 0011 1180 R SWAP _tempinta[1]
108 0012 0FF0 MOV A,0F0H
108 0013 0680 R ANDM A,_tempinta[1]
108 0014 1100 R SWAPA _tempinta
108 0015 0E0F AND A,0FH
108 0016 0580 R ORM A,_tempinta[1]
文件:PowerU.c 盛群編譯器版本 3.00 頁次3
108 0017 1180 R SWAP _tempinta
108 0018 0FF0 MOV A,0F0H
108 0019 0680 R ANDM A,_tempinta
109 001A #line 109 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
109 001A 1120 SWAPA __adrl
109 001B 0E0F AND A,0FH
109 001C 0080 R MOV b0_3,A
109 001D 0700 R MOV A,b0_3
109 001E 0380 R ADDM A,_tempinta
109 001F 1F05 CLR [05H]
109 0020 1380 R ADCM A,_tempinta[1]
111 0021 #line 111 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
111 0021 0F00 MOV A,00h
111 0022 0080 R MOV _templonga,A
111 0023 0F40 MOV A,040h
111 0024 0080 R MOV _templonga[1],A
111 0025 0F9C MOV A,09ch
111 0026 0080 R MOV _templonga[2],A
111 0027 0F00 MOV A,00h
111 0028 0080 R MOV _templonga[3],A
112 0029 #line 112 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
112 0029 0700 R MOV A,_tempinta
112 002A 0080 R MOV b0_3,A
112 002B 0700 R MOV A,_tempinta[1]
112 002C 0080 R MOV b0_3[1],A
112 002D 1F00 R CLR b0_3[2]
112 002E 1F00 R CLR b0_3[3]
112 002F 0700 R MOV A,_templonga
112 0030 0080 E MOV T2,A
112 0031 0700 R MOV A,_templonga[1]
112 0032 0080 E MOV RH,A
112 0033 0700 R MOV A,_templonga[2]
112 0034 0080 E MOV RM,A
112 0035 0700 R MOV A,_templonga[3]
112 0036 0080 E MOV RU,A
112 0037 0700 R MOV A,b0_3[3]
112 0038 0080 E MOV T6,A
112 0039 0700 R MOV A,b0_3[2]
112 003A 0080 E MOV T5,A
112 003B 0700 R MOV A,b0_3[1]
112 003C 0080 E MOV T4,A
112 003D 0700 R MOV A,b0_3
112 003E 0080 E MOV T3,A
112 003F 2000 E CALL DIVUL4
112 0040 0700 E MOV A,RU
112 0041 0080 R MOV _templonga[3],A
112 0042 0700 E MOV A,RM
112 0043 0080 R MOV _templonga[2],A
112 0044 0700 E MOV A,RH
112 0045 0080 R MOV _templonga[1],A
112 0046 0700 E MOV A,T2
112 0047 0080 R MOV _templonga,A
113 0048 #line 113 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
113 0048 0700 R MOV A,_templonga
113 0049 0080 R MOV _battery_voltage,A
113 004A 0700 R MOV A,_templonga[1]
113 004B 0080 R MOV _battery_voltage[1],A
114 004C #line 114 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
114 004C 0700 R MOV A,_battery_voltage[1]
114 004D 0080 E MOV RH,A
文件:PowerU.c 盛群編譯器版本 3.00 頁次4
114 004E 0700 R MOV A,_battery_voltage
114 004F L3:
114 004F 0003 RET
114 0000 0004[ LOCAL b0_3 DB 4 DUP(?)
00
]
114 0050 _ADC_GetBatteryData ENDP
118 0050 #line 118 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
118 0000 @just_discharge .SECTION 'CODE'
118 0000 PUBLIC _just_discharge
118 0000 _just_discharge PROC
118 0000 #pragma debug scope 7 1 ; 119 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
119 0000 #line 119 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
119 0000 2000 R CALL _ADC_GetBatteryData
119 0001 0080 R MOV _battery_voltage,A
119 0002 0700 E MOV A,RH
119 0003 0080 R MOV _battery_voltage[1],A
120 0004 #line 120 "H:\Project\HCX\Project\20110920_H061V1_后備電池方案9-HT-深飛\FW\X01\PowerU.c"
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-